ABSTRACT:
The method of determining interactions due to direct currents on adjacent buried metal structures at least one of which is connected to a direct current generator such as a cathodic protection device, consists in placing calibrated specimen test metal pieces in the vicinity of the buried metal structures, the test pieces being made of materials that are analogous to those of the structures. The test pieces are spaced apart from each other by a distance L' equal to the distance L between the structures. Reference electrodes are placed in the immediate proximity of the specimen metal test pieces and simultaneous measurements are performed firstly of the potentials of the specimen test pieces relative to the reference electrodes, and secondly of the currents flowing through the calibrated specimen test pieces when they are electrically connected to respective ones of the structures.
